i have had one for the past 3 months.. Great synth.. the Karma feature is excellent for live use.. pretty much a Triton without the touchscreen and sampler..but you do get the Karma feature which has to be heard to be believed.. It ain't a fancy arpeggiator.. It is much more than that.. Imagine having 4 simultanoues arps running..with 16 realtime controls over various elements of the patterns ie.. swing, duration, gate, velocity, filter, adlib.. there are over 1400 ge's (korg speak for the attributes that you can change).. you can assign any of these to each sound.. With the new Karma ME software you can write your own GE's to suit your own style of music, but i have found the pre installed ones will suit most tastes add to that all your standard filter stuff like cutoff/resonance etc It transmits everything via midi, so all those lovely karmafied beats/riffs can be sent to any piece of midi gear.. Keep in mind it has a steep learning curve but with a bit of time the results are excellent.. check out www.karma-lab.com |
